RPM

Have you tried the popular RPM

RPM is a 60-minute indoor cycling class based on outdoor riding. You ride to inspirational music over the equivalent of 20-25 kilometres of varied terrain, controlling the intensity of your workout with a resistance dial and pedal speed.

HATHA YOGA CLASSES ADELAIDE

Hatha Yoga classes are held regularly at Blackwood Fitness Adelaide and is approximately 15 to 20 minutes from the CBD Adelaide.

Hatha Yoga is a physical activity that uses an awareness of the breath to link, unify and balance the many aspects of the body and mind, allowing them to operate as one functional unit.

These are the main components of Hatha Yoga:

ü  Stretching

ü  Isometric strengthening

ü  Isotonic strengthening

ü  Isokinetic strengthening

ü  Joint range of movement exercises

ü  One-legged (balance) exercises

ü  Cardiovascular (aerobic) conditioning

ü  Breathing awareness

ü  Unilateral nostril breathing

ü  Sense control

ü  Concentration

ü  Relaxation

ü  Visualisation

ü  Meditation

Our Adelaide Hatha Yoga classes consist of physical exercises (asana) and breath control (pranayama). The exercises can be static or slow moving stretches followed by a period of relaxation.

They can also be strenuous, fast and may include repetitive exercises that resemble calisthenics and gymnastics. Yoga exercises are most beneficial when strength and vigor are balanced with flexibility and relaxation.

Students of yoga gradually become accustomed to hearing and using sanskrit terms and names, such as “asanas” for exercise, or posture.

“Sanskrit” is the classic language of yoga, having evolved from the early languages of Europe and India.

The names of yoga postures often describe activities and objects from daily life and living. They also include animals, plants and elements from our natural environment, reminding us of our connectedness with our surroundings and oneness with all things.
